This only affects Hero Lab for iPad, and the built-in Dropbox syncing for that app. Hero Lab doesn't directly talk to Dropbox in any other way - it won't affect sharing your characters between your laptop and desktop using Dropbox, or updates files hosted by dropbox, or anything like that. All that stuff is built in to the Dropbox client you have installed and won't change.

This change means that there will no longer be a "Files in Dropbox" section on the "Select Portfolio" screen on HL for iPad. That's all. :)

Looking into the this v2 API from dropbox its design and functions is very different from the old one. Meaning its not just a simple plug in v2 and use it. I would not be surprised to see it require a significant amount of work on Colen's part to make it work.

That being the case maybe spending a little time looking for "alternate" solutions is a better approach. If large project has to happen anyways maybe their is a better alternative like iCloud instead. I have heard its API's are much better now.

Just to be clear you can "sort" of still use Dropbox or any cloud solution with the iPad app. If you download the dropbox app you can use it to gain access to your .por file stored in dropbox. Then you do a "Open In" and one of the options is "HL App". That will get the file from dropbox to HL.

Now then to get the file "out" of HL currently requires you to "email" it to yourself. Then you could place it into Dropbox. Make changes on your computer. Once done use the dropbox app to get it back into HL.

Yes I know its NOT perfect and its more 'steps' but it works. Otherwise you will need to use iTunes just like when the HL app first came out.
